The white paper makes an in-depth analysis on current and future challenges that telecommunication network optimization & maintenance faces. It indicates that the next-generation SON (NG SON) based on Massive Data and Cloud Computing will realize automation and intellectualization of all work with known input and output in current network, and become the enabler of Cloud-RAN. It points out that the most important driver of NG SON is to improve operation efficiency with evolving MBB network. In addition, NG SON will be a built-in module in RAN, designed and developed with RAN together. New technologies and services such as scenario oriented SON, experience oriented SON and gird level SON are the vital capabilities of NG SON. This white paper has important reference value to the automotive O&M for 4.5G and 5G network.
